云服务器是虚拟机吗?云服务器是基于容器还是虚拟机?深度解析云服务的技术架构与演进趋势
- 综合资讯
- 2025-04-17 19:09:22
- 2

云服务器是一种基于云计算的弹性计算服务,其底层技术架构主要采用虚拟机(VM)和容器(Container)两种虚拟化方式,虚拟机通过硬件抽象层模拟完整操作系统环境,实现跨...
云服务器是一种基于云计算的弹性计算服务,其底层技术架构主要采用虚拟机(VM)和容器(Container)两种虚拟化方式,虚拟机通过硬件抽象层模拟完整操作系统环境,实现跨平台兼容性,但资源占用较高;容器(如Docker)基于操作系统内核共享,以轻量化、快速部署和高效资源利用为特点,成为现代云服务的主流技术之一,当前云服务架构呈现分层化演进趋势:底层依托物理服务器集群,中间层通过虚拟化技术实现资源池化,上层则结合容器编排(如Kubernetes)构建微服务架构,随着无服务器(Serverless)和边缘计算的发展,云服务正从传统虚拟化向混合云、容器化、智能化方向演进,同时强化了跨平台互联与自动化运维能力。
云服务技术架构的底层逻辑
在云计算技术快速发展的今天,"云服务器"这一概念已成为企业数字化转型的核心基础设施,当我们讨论云服务器的基础架构时,一个关键性问题始终存在:云服务器究竟是依托传统虚拟机技术运行,还是基于新兴容器化架构实现?本文将通过系统性分析,从技术原理、应用场景、行业实践三个维度,深入探讨云服务器的技术演进路径,揭示容器与虚拟机在云环境中的协同关系。
第一章 技术原理对比:虚拟机与容器的架构解析
1 虚拟机技术(Virtual Machine)
虚拟机通过硬件抽象层(Hypervisor)实现物理资源的虚拟化,其核心架构包含以下关键组件:
-
硬件抽象层(Hypervisor):包括Type-1(裸金属)和Type-2(宿主型)两种形态,前者直接运行在物理硬件上(如VMware ESXi、KVM),后者则依托宿主操作系统(如VirtualBox)。
-
资源隔离机制:每个虚拟机拥有独立的CPU调度器、内存空间、存储设备和网络接口卡(NIC),通过硬件级隔离确保安全性和稳定性。
图片来源于网络,如有侵权联系删除
-
操作系统级虚拟化:支持Windows Server、Linux等完整操作系统实例,实现应用与宿主环境的完全解耦。
以AWS EC2实例为例,其c5.4xlarge实例采用NVIDIA T4 GPU虚拟化技术,通过硬件辅助虚拟化(HV)实现每秒240万次浮点运算,验证了虚拟机技术在高性能计算场景的适用性。
2 容器技术(Container)
容器通过命名空间(Namespace)和控制组(CGroup)实现进程级隔离,其技术特征表现为:
-
轻量化架构:相比虚拟机仅需MB级存储空间(如Docker镜像约1-5GB),容器启动时间缩短至秒级(传统虚拟机需分钟级)。
-
进程隔离机制:共享宿主机的内核,通过cgroups限制CPU、内存等资源,避免系统级资源争用。
-
标准化镜像格式:Docker镜像采用 layered filesystem 模式,支持多阶段构建优化,构建时间可压缩至传统包管理器的1/10。
阿里云ECS容器服务(ECS Container Service)的实践表明,在微服务架构中,容器化部署使应用迭代频率提升300%,资源利用率提高45%,某电商平台在"双11"期间通过Kubernetes集群管理3000+容器实例,弹性扩缩容响应时间控制在30秒以内。
3 技术演进图谱(2010-2023)
技术阶段 | 关键技术 | 典型应用 | 资源效率 |
---|---|---|---|
虚拟化1.0 | Type-1 Hypervisor | 企业ERP系统迁移 | 20-30% |
容器化1.0 | Docker 1.0 | 微服务架构 | 50-60% |
混合云1.0 | OpenStack | 跨地域部署 | 70-80% |
容器化2.0 | Kubernetes | 智能调度 | 85-90% |
Serverless 1.0 | AWS Lambda | 事件驱动 | 95+ |
(数据来源:Gartner 2023云计算报告)
第二章 云服务器的实现形态分析
1 纯虚拟机架构
典型代表:AWS EC2传统实例、Azure VM系列
-
优势:完整硬件访问权限、支持大型工作负载(如64路CPU)、符合传统运维流程
-
局限:资源碎片化(平均利用率仅30%)、启动延迟(5-15分钟)、网络性能损耗(约15-20%)
某金融核心系统迁移案例显示,采用4台r4.4xlarge虚拟机集群(每台16核64GB)处理每秒2万笔交易时,存在15%的CPU调度延迟和12%的内存碎片问题。
2 纯容器架构
典型代表:AWS ECS、Google GKE
-
优势:分钟级部署、90%+资源利用率、热更新零停机
图片来源于网络,如有侵权联系删除
-
挑战:内核版本锁定(如Alpine Linux 3.18)、安全加固复杂度(CVE漏洞影响范围扩大3倍)、企业级监控适配
某物流调度系统采用2000+容器实例实现日均10亿次订单处理,但遭遇容器逃逸攻击导致数据泄露事件,暴露出容器安全防护的薄弱环节。
3 混合云架构
阿里云"云原生"战略的实践路径:
-
分层架构:底层虚拟化集群(vSphere)+ 中间容器编排(K8s)+ 应用层Serverless(ARMS)
-
资源池化:将32核物理服务器拆分为128个容器节点,支持每秒5000次API调用
-
智能调度:基于Prometheus+Grafana构建的动态资源分配系统,使GPU利用率从35%提升至82%
该架构在2022年某国际赛事直播中成功处理1200路4K视频流,单集群资源消耗降低40%。
第三章 行业实践与选型策略
1 企业级选型矩阵
评估维度 | 虚拟机适用场景 | 容器适用场景 | 混合架构场景 |
---|---|---|---|
工作负载类型 | ERP系统、大型数据库 | 微服务、API网关 | 复杂混合应用 |
迭代频率 | 低频(季度级) | 高频(日/小时级) | 双模开发环境 |
安全要求 | 传统合规审计 | 零信任架构 | 等保三级 |
成本预算 | $500+/月 | $200+/月 | $800+/月(混合) |
运维团队 | 现有IT部门 | DevOps团队 | 跨职能小组 |
(数据来源:Forrester 2023企业云服务调研)
2 典型案例深度解析
案例1:某跨国零售企业上云
- 挑战:全球12个区域数据中心,日均处理1.2亿订单,需满足GDPR合规要求
- 方案:混合云架构(AWS+本地DC)
- 虚拟机集群:部署SAP HANA数据库(32台r5实例)
- 容器集群:Kafka消息队列(500节点)
- 成效:合规审计时间从3个月缩短至72小时,订单处理延迟降低至50ms
案例2:某生物制药企业研发平台
- 需求:支持2000+科研人员并行计算,每实验需启动500+容器实例
- 方案:Docker on Kubernetes + GPU共享集群
- 资源池化:128块A100 GPU拆分为256个容器单元
- 安全设计:基于Seccomp和AppArmor的沙箱机制
- 成果:单次药物筛选周期从14天压缩至3.5天
3 技术选型决策树
graph TD A[确定工作负载类型] --> B{是否为微服务架构?} B -->|是| C[选择容器方案] B -->|否| D{是否需要长期运行?} D -->|是| E[选择虚拟机方案] D -->|否| F[考虑Serverless] A -->|混合云需求| G[设计混合架构]
第四章 安全与合规挑战
1 虚拟机安全威胁链
- 攻击路径:Hypervisor漏洞(如VMware CVE-2021-21985)→ 主机入侵 → 容器逃逸 → 数据泄露
- 防护措施:
- 微隔离技术(AWS Security Groups + NACLs)
- 审计日志分析(ELK Stack + SIEM)
- 联邦学习模型:某银行通过联合训练保护虚拟机指纹隐私
2 容器安全防护体系
-
分层防护模型:
- 容器层:Seccomp过滤(阻止敏感系统调用)
- 集群层:Calico网络策略(微隔离)
- 基础设施层:Docker Trusted Build(镜像签名验证)
-
安全增强实践:
- 某电商平台实施"白盒容器"技术,在启动阶段验证镜像完整性
- 基于差分隐私的日志脱敏(k-匿名算法+AES-256加密)
3 合规性要求对比
合规标准 | 虚拟机要求 | 容器要求 | 混合架构要求 |
---|---|---|---|
GDPR | 数据本地化 | 容器生命周期审计 | 跨区域数据同步 |
等保2.0 | 双因素认证 | 容器镜像白名单 | 零信任网络 |
HIPAA | 容灾演练 | 敏感数据沙箱 | 容器密钥轮换 |
(数据来源:中国信通院《云安全白皮书2023》)
第五章 技术演进趋势
1 虚拟化技术革新
- 硬件发展:Intel vTPM 2.0支持全生命周期加密,AMD SEV-SNP提供内存隔离
- 性能突破:AWS Nitro System 2.0实现网络延迟<10μs,CPU调度延迟<1ms
- 绿色计算:华为云智能布线技术使PUE值降至1.15,年节省电力相当于1.2个三峡电站
2 容器技术发展方向
- eBPF技术:Cilium项目实现容器网络性能提升300%,攻击检测率提高85%
- Serverless容器化:AWS Lambda@2支持容器运行时,冷启动时间从8秒降至200ms
- AI原生容器:Google KubeEdge实现边缘设备容器管理,推理延迟<5ms
3 混合云架构演进
- 跨云治理:CNCF Cross-Cloud CNI项目支持多云容器编排,配置一致性达98%
- 统一管理平面:阿里云云效平台实现物理服务器、虚拟机、容器的统一纳管
- 量子计算融合:IBM Quantum System Two通过容器化接口接入Kubernetes集群
第六章 未来展望与建议
1 技术融合路径预测
- 2024-2025:容器成为云服务默认形态,虚拟机保留在特殊场景
- 2026-2030:统一计算单元(Unified Compute Unit)实现虚拟机/容器/Serverless无缝切换
- 2030+:基于DNA存储的云服务器,单节点存储容量达EB级
2 企业转型路线图
- 短期(0-6个月):建立容器化CI/CD流水线,替换30%传统部署
- 中期(6-24个月):构建混合云管理平台,实现资源利用率提升40%
- 长期(24-36个月):部署AI运维助手(AIOps),降低50%运维成本
3 风险预警与应对
- 技术债务:某银行因过度容器化导致监控盲区扩大,需投入200人日修复
- 技能缺口:2023年云计算岗位需求中,K8s工程师薪资溢价达45%
- 法律风险:欧盟《云服务法案》要求供应商提供容器镜像完整生命周期记录
构建云原生时代的弹性架构
云服务器的技术演进本质上是企业数字化转型能力的映射,在容器与虚拟机的协同进化中,关键不在于选择单一技术路径,而在于建立灵活的架构体系,未来云服务将呈现"容器为底座、Serverless为补充、虚拟机为特例"的混合形态,企业需通过持续的技术投资(年均不低于营收的3.5%)、组织架构调整(设立云原生中心组)和流程再造(DevSecOps实施率需达80%),方能在数字经济的浪潮中构建可持续的竞争优势。
(全文共计3872字,原创内容占比92.3%)
本文链接:https://www.zhitaoyun.cn/2135083.html
发表评论